The Itinerary in Detail

Your journey begins with a warm welcome, setting a friendly tone. The first highlight is the lecture about dashi and umami—the fundamental flavors that give Japanese food its savory depth. This part is especially valued, with reviewers noting their newfound understanding of how dashi forms the backbone of dishes from soups to desserts.

Next, you’ll see the preparation of three types of dashi—kelp (kombu), bonito flakes (katsuobushi), and mixed (awase). Watching these ingredients being made from scratch is both educational and visually appealing. You’ll learn how each contributes different umami qualities, and you’ll get the chance to taste all three side-by-side, which many find enlightening. One reviewer mentioned, “I didn’t know Dashi was everything and the base of Japanese cuisine,” highlighting how this session broadens culinary appreciation.

Following this, you’ll observe a demonstration of miso soup and traditional side dishes, including tips on plating that make the dishes look as good as they taste. The instructor’s explanations make the process accessible, even for beginners.

The hands-on part kicks off with the fluffy dashimaki tamago, cooked in a traditional rectangular pan. We loved the way the instructor guides you through achieving that perfect, softly rolled omelet—an art in itself. Then, you choose fillings—from classic grilled salmon to pickled vegetables—and shape your own onigiri by hand. This part is particularly fun, with reviewers noting that shaping rice balls was both satisfying and surprisingly easy with proper guidance.
